Upptäck Memphis rika historia, musikaliska arv och södra köket på denna omfattande "det bästa av Memphis" turné. Ta in alla höjdpunkter i centrala Memphis, från Blues barer på Beale Street och historiska viktorianska herrgårdar, till platsen där Martin Luther King Jr mördades och en av Elvis tidiga lägenheter. Få inblick i stadens fantastiska arv på National Civil Rights Museu, platsen för mordet på Dr Martin Luther King, Jr. Efter att ha besökt det museum du valt, kommer du att köras säkert tillbaka till Beale St., eller till Memphis Riverboat för att njuta av en naturskön kryssning på Mississippifloden.

- Vi kan ta emot hopfällbara rullatorer eller rullstolar. Vi har ingen rullstolslyft och kan därför inte hjälpa dem som sitter i motordrivna rullstolar eller saknar rörlighet.
- Inom några kvarter finns fyra olika parkeringshus, och flera utomhusparkeringar. Närmaste garage till vår plats (bara två kvarter bort) är 149 Peabody Place mellan Second Street och BB King Blvd., bredvid Hampton Inn. Du kan prova lyckan med parkering på gatan också, på Second Street strax söder om Beale, på Beale mellan Front och Second; eller längs Peabody Place från Front till Fourth Street.
- Memphis Riverboat ligger på botten av en 35% lutning täckt med historiska kullerstenar. På grund av kullerstenarnas historiska karaktär är det inte tillåtet att släppa av passagerare direkt vid båtbryggan. Gästerna kommer att släppas av och hämtas från Riverside Dr.
